Prediction markets have become an unexpected arena for betting on the existence of extraterrestrial life. According to the latest data from two leading platforms, traders now see a significant chance that the U.S. government will officially confirm alien life in 2026 — Polymarket puts the probability at 20%, while Kalshi is even more bullish at 22.5%.

Trump and FBI Signal Transparency on UAP Files

The surge in odds was triggered by high-level political signals. On May 4, 2026, former President Donald Trump announced that the Pentagon would release a trove of documents related to Unidentified Anomalous Phenomena (UAP). “We’ll be releasing a lot of things we haven’t released before. Some of it will be very interesting for people,” he stated. Shortly after, FBI Director Kash Patel confirmed that UAP files had already been submitted for declassification and public release.

These pledges quickly moved the prediction markets. The Polymarket contract titled “US government confirms alien life in 2026” jumped from single-digit odds to 20% within days. Kalshi’s similar contract reached 22.5%, marking the highest ever for an extraterrestrial-themed bet on that platform.

Pastors Meet with Intelligence Officials

Perhaps more surprising than official promises are claims from religious leaders. Three pastors independently reported that six clergy members held meetings with intelligence officers to discuss how the church should respond after an official disclosure event. American missionary and podcaster Tony Merkel stated that the officials were “Christians working in intelligence, and their initial stated goal was to gather data and evidence on what’s really happening behind the scenes within the disclosure community.”

This revelation has fueled speculation that the government might be quietly preparing for a major announcement. While no concrete evidence exists, the narraative of “soft disclosure” is gaining traction among prediction market traders.

Obama Dismisses Government Secrecy

Not everyone is convinced. Former President Barack Obama addressed the topic in a recent interview, dismissing claims that the government harbors aliens. “If there were aliens or alien spacecraft under the control of the U.S. government… I promise you, one of the guards at the facility would have taken a selfie with the alien and sent it to his girlfriend to impress her,” he said. Obama acknowledged the possibility of life in the universe but insisted no hidden evidence exists.

Obama’s remarks briefly cooled Polymarket odds, but the dip was quickly reversed by Trump’s new promises and the FBI file news. The market now reflects a sharp divide: some traders are betting on a full disclosure, while others see the hype as political theater.

How Prediction Markets Are Shaping the UFO Narrative

Platforms like Polymarket and Kalshi have become unconventional barometers for the extraterrestrial debate. Unlike traditional media or government investigations, prediction markets use real money to aggregate collective judgment. Historically, such markets have shown reasonable accuracy for events like elections, pandemics, and tech breakthroughs. However, the extreme uncertainty and information asymmetry surrounding alien life disclosure make these bets highly speculative.

Notably, current probabilities are far higher than any previous year. In 2025, the same contract peaked at just 5%. Within the first few months of 2026, odds have quadrupled. Whether this reflects genuine insider knowledge or simply a meme-driven frenzy remains to be seen. Time will tell if the U.S. government is truly ready to break decades of silence.
